如何提高代码质量和可维护性

软件测试视界 2023-09-23 ⋅ 19 阅读

作为程序开发者,提高代码质量和可维护性是我们始终追求的目标。优秀的代码质量和可维护性不仅能够提高团队的开发效率,还可以减少后期维护和调试的工作量。在本文中,我将介绍一些方法和技巧,帮助你提升代码质量和可维护性。

1. 编写清晰且可读性高的代码

清晰的代码是指能够清楚地表达出程序的逻辑和功能。编写清晰代码的关键是命名规范和注释。命名要具有描述性,能够直观地表达出变量、函数和类的用途。注释应该简洁明了,解释代码的意图和思路,以及特殊情况下的处理方式。

除了命名和注释外,良好的代码缩进和格式化也是非常重要的。通过合理的代码缩进,可以更加清晰地表达出代码的层次和结构,提高代码的可读性。

2. 使用设计模式和优雅的代码结构

设计模式是一套被广泛使用的代码组织和设计原则,它可以帮助我们在开发过程中遇到的各种问题。通过使用设计模式,我们可以使代码结构更加清晰,易于理解和维护。常用的设计模式包括单例模式、工厂模式、观察者模式等。

此外,遵循一些优雅的代码结构也是提高代码可维护性的关键。比如,避免使用过长的函数和类,将复杂的逻辑拆分成小的函数或方法,尽量避免使用全局变量等。这些都有助于代码的组织和复用。

3. 引入代码审查和测试

代码审查是一种有效的提高代码质量的方法。通过让其他团队成员检查和审查我们的代码,可以发现潜在的问题和改进的空间。代码审查不仅可以提高代码的质量,还可以促进团队之间的交流和学习。

测试也是提高代码质量和可维护性的重要手段。编写自动化测试用例可以帮助我们及时发现和修复代码中的bug,保证代码的正确性和稳定性。同时,测试还可以作为一种文档和规范,使代码更加可读和可维护。

4. 持续学习和改进

程序开发是一个不断进步的过程,我们需要持续地学习和改进自己的编码技巧和方法。阅读优秀的代码、参与社区讨论、参加技术分享会等都是提高自身编码水平的有效途径。

此外,及时反思和总结自己的开发经验也是非常重要的。我们可以通过回顾自己的代码,思考其中的不足之处,以及如何在类似的情况下做得更好。这样我们就能不断进步,提升自己的代码质量和可维护性。

总结

提高代码质量和可维护性是每个程序开发者的目标,也是一个长期的过程。通过编写清晰且可读性高的代码、使用设计模式和优雅的代码结构、引入代码审查和测试、持续学习和改进,我们可以不断提升自己的编码水平,写出更高质量、更易维护的代码。希望这些方法和技巧能够对你有所帮助!


全部评论: 0

    我有话说: